WebBones absorb and release mineral _____ to maintain mineral homeostasis. salts The skeleton produces ____ cells that are used in the cardiovascular system. blood As … WebOct 6, 2024 · After about age 30, bones slowly lose calcium. In middle age, bone loss speeds up and can lead to weak, fragile bones (osteoporosis) and broken bones (fractures). Although bone loss is more common in women, it can affect men too. Silica for Bone Health. 80前夕防骑雕文WebSep 28, 2016 · The body maintains very tight control over the calcium circulating in the blood at any given time. The equilibrium is maintained by an elegant interplay of calcium absorbed from the intestines, movement of calcium into and out of the bones, and the kidney’s reclamation and excretion of calcium into the urine.
